Output 8afc110589eaa825b2acaa2699df4849fcbb3e4a3dbcfbf9363316e297763297:1

value
684888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e85f512b15bbdcb9455be770262e4d99fb9a852c OP_EQUAL
address
3Nsgso1c3R6tGAu1WzJj7MnP3pSyzkqg3W
transaction
8afc110589eaa825b2acaa2699df4849fcbb3e4a3dbcfbf9363316e297763297